

PSPG Orders dashboard showing real-time payment logs and transaction statuses
PlanetStudio Payment Gateway allows merchants to accept online payments via Armenian banks, as well as the Idram and Telcell wallet payment systems.
This plugin provides the PSPG Core and PayLink payments.
Additional platform integrations (such as WooCommerce, GiveWP, WPForms and PayForm) are available as separate add-ons.
PlanetStudio Payment Gateway supports multiple Armenian acquiring banks, test and production modes, and provides detailed payment and callback logs in the WordPress admin area.
Depending on the selected bank or payment system, merchants may need to obtain API credentials or other access details from their bank or payment provider.
ArCa (Armenian Card)
– ACBA Bank (ACBABank)
– Araratbank (Ararat Bank)
– Armeconombank (Armeconom Bank)
– Armswissbank (Armswiss Bank)
– Ardshinbank (Ardshin Bank)
– Byblos Bank Armenia
– Converse Bank
– Evocabank (Evoca Bank)
– Fast Bank
– IDBank (ID Bank)
Banks with independent processing
– AMIO Bank
– Ameriabank (Ameria Bank)
– Inecobank (Ineco, Ineco Bank)
Other payment systems
– Idram Wallet
– Telcell Wallet
PlanetStudio Payment Gateway includes a PayLink feature that allows administrators
to create payment links (including QR-based flows) manually and send them to customers
via email, messengers, or any other communication channel.
PayLink works independently from e-commerce or donation plugins and can be used
for manual payments, invoices, advance payments, or one-time charges.
How PayLink works:
PayForm functionality is available via a separate add-on.
The PayForm add-on allows administrators to embed a customizable public payment form using a shortcode and process payments through PSPG-supported banks.
PlanetStudio Payment Gateway provides a Core payment framework.
Additional integrations such as WooCommerce, GiveWP, and PayForm, eHDM (Էլեկտրոնային ՀԴՄ) are available as separate add-ons.
After activating the plugin, go to the PSPG settings page in the WordPress admin area and configure at least one payment provider.
To start using the plugin:
The core plugin includes built-in PayLink functionality and can be used without WooCommerce or other add-ons.
The easiest way to test the plugin is using the built-in PayLink feature.
If no payment provider is configured, PayLink and other payment flows will not work.
This plugin requires merchant credentials provided by the selected Armenian bank or payment provider.
Depending on the provider, you may need:
– test credentials for sandbox/testing
– live credentials for production
– provider-specific merchant settings
WooCommerce, GiveWP, and PayForm integrations are available as separate add-ons and are not required to test the core PayLink functionality.
PlanetStudio Payment Gateway can integrate with the separate PlanetStudio eHDM (Էլեկտրոնային ՀԴՄ) plugin for fiscal receipt handling.
eHDM (Էլեկտրոնային ՀԴՄ) is an optional external plugin and is not required for PSPG operation.
This plugin connects to external services only when the corresponding payment method or PayLink functionality is configured and used.
The plugin does not send customer banking credentials to these services.
When a payment is initiated, the plugin may send transaction-related data required by the selected provider, such as:
– payment amount
– currency
– payment description
– merchant order or transaction identifier
– return / callback URL needed to complete the payment flow
This plugin can connect to the ArCa payment infrastructure to process card payments for supported ArCa-based banks.
This service is used only when an ArCa-based payment method is enabled and selected for payment.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URLs:
– https://ipay.arca.am
– https://ipaytest.arca.am
Privacy policy:
– https://arca.am/privacy-policy
This plugin can connect to Ameriabank vPOS to process card payments.
This service is used only when the Ameriabank payment method is enabled and selected for payment.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URLs:
– https://services.ameriabank.am
– https://servicestest.ameriabank.am
Privacy policy:
– https://ameriabank.am/website-privacy-policy
This plugin can connect to AMIO Bank payment endpoints to process card payments.
This service is used only when the AMIO Bank payment method is enabled and selected for payment.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URLs:
– https://epg.armbusinessbank.am
– https://epg-test.armbusinessbank.am
Legal / service information:
– https://amiobank.am/en/legal-documents
This plugin can connect to IDBank payment infrastructure to process card payments.
This service is used only when the IDBank payment method is enabled and selected for payment.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URL:
– https://ipayproxy.idp.am
Terms:
– https://idbank.am/en/information/helpfull-information/Remote-services-ENG.pdf
Privacy policy:
– https://idbank.am/documents/RL-0900-0001-01_ENG.pdf
This plugin can connect to Inecobank payment endpoints to process card payments.
This service is used only when the Inecobank payment method is enabled and selected for payment.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URLs:
– https://pg.inecoecom.am
– https://ipaytest.inecobank.am
– https://ipay.inecobank.am
Privacy policy:
– https://www.inecobank.am/en/useful-information/privacy-policy
This plugin can connect to Idram Wallet services to process wallet-based payments.
This service is used only when the Idram payment method is enabled and selected for payment.
Depending on the payment flow and provider-side functionality, the plugin may also connect to Idram authentication and related service endpoints.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URLs:
– https://banking.idram.am
– https://csauth.idram.am
– https://cashback.idram.am
Terms:
– https://www.idram.am/Media/Documents/terms-and-conditions-eng.pdf
Privacy policy:
– https://money.idram.am/en/documents/privacy.htm
This plugin can connect to Telcell Wallet services to process wallet-based payments.
This service is used only when the Telcell payment method is enabled and selected for payment.
Depending on the payment flow and provider-side functionality, the plugin may also connect to Telcell payment and related service endpoints.
Data sent may include:
– payment amount
– currency
– payment description
– merchant order identifier
– return URL / callback URL
Service URLs:
– https://telcellmoney.am
Terms:
– https://telcell.am/en/legal-acts
This plugin can connect to the goQR / QRServer API to generate QR code images for PSPG PayLink pages.
This service is used only when a PayLink page with QR code output is generated or displayed.
Data sent may include:
– the PayLink URL that should be encoded into the QR code
No payment card data, banking credentials, or customer authentication data are sent to this service.
Service URL:
– https://api.qrserver.com
Terms:
– https://goqr.me/legal/tos-api.html
Privacy policy:
– https://goqr.me/privacy-safety-security/